-
公开(公告)号:US20240155160A1
公开(公告)日:2024-05-09
申请号:US18280551
申请日:2021-03-10
Applicant: GOOGLE LLC
Inventor: Richard Xie , Ramachandra Tahasildar , Danny Hong , Alex Sukhanov , Albert Julius Liu , Beril Erkin
IPC: H04N19/86 , A63F13/355 , H04N19/119 , H04N19/186
CPC classification number: H04N19/86 , A63F13/355 , H04N19/119 , H04N19/186 , A63F13/358
Abstract: Real-time pre-encoding dithering techniques mitigate or eliminate banding and other graphical artifacts in video frames prior to such video frames being encoded for transmission to and display by one or more client devices. For each of one or more input video frames, one or more random seeds and a frame identifier are received, and a dithering process is initiated for each of one or more pixels of the input video frame. The dithering process includes generating a YUV noise vector based on the random seeds and on the frame identifier, computing a YUV representation of the input pixel based on RGB color information for the input pixel, and generating a dithered output pixel by adding the generated YUV noise vector to the YUV representation of the input pixel.